Choline Chloride Emerging as a Cornerstone Nutrient and Industrial Additive Driving Diverse Sectoral Transformations Worldwide
Choline chloride has quickly gained prominence as an essential nutrient supplement in animal feed and as an indispensable intermediate in diverse industrial processes. Its unique chemical structure supports cell membrane integrity and neurotransmitter synthesis, making it critical to animal growth performance and human health formulations. Over the past decade, awareness of its multifaceted benefits has accelerated adoption across aquaculture, poultry, swine, and ruminant nutrition, as well as dietary supplements targeting cognitive function and liver support.The production of choline chloride bridges the gap between chemical innovation and nutritional science. Its role in enhancing feed conversion ratios and reducing mortality rates among livestock has solidified its position as a key ingredient in modern feed formulations. Simultaneously, expanding interest in tailored dietary supplements has driven formulators to leverage choline chloride in capsule, powder, and liquid forms. This dual application underscores the compound's versatility and restructures value chains within both agricultural and pharmaceutical sectors.

Strategic Insights into Choline Chloride Market Segmentation Revealing Crucial Trends across Form Application Purity Production and Distribution
Analyzing the market by form reveals that liquid variants continue to dominate applications where rapid solubility and precise dosing are paramount, especially in aquaculture and livestock feed. Conversely, solid forms offer logistical advantages for applications requiring extended shelf life and ease of transport, often preferred in regions with less developed cold chain infrastructure. This distinction informs strategic decisions around packaging investment and distribution network design.When examining application segments, it becomes evident that animal feed remains the cornerstone of demand, with sub segments such as aquaculture, poultry, ruminant, and swine exhibiting unique growth trajectories influenced by regional dietary preferences and regulatory requirements. The dietary supplement sector leverages a variety of formats including capsules, liquids, powders, and tablets to address consumer demands for cognitive health and liver function support, highlighting the importance of formulation flexibility. Meanwhile, food and beverage manufacturers integrate choline chloride as an emulsifying agent and nutritional fortifier, and pharmaceutical producers utilize high-purity grades for excipient applications in tablets and injectables.
Purity grade variation impacts end use and pricing dynamics, with feed grade meeting bulk nutritional requirements, food grade aligning with stringent food safety standards, pharma grade servicing medicinal formulations, and technical grade catering to industrial intermediates. Differentiation in production processes further shapes market offerings, as producers utilizing methyl chloride routes often emphasize cost efficiency, whereas PCl3 methods yield higher purity levels suitable for supplement and pharmaceutical markets. Distribution strategies range from direct sales to distributors operating at national and regional levels, online channels spanning manufacturer websites and third-party platforms, and retail outlets including pharmacies, specialty stores, and supermarkets. Each channel presents unique challenges and opportunities, with digital commerce emerging as a critical pathway for reaching diverse customer segments.
In Depth Regional Analysis Highlighting Distinct Drivers Opportunities and Constraints across Americas Europe Middle East Africa and Asia Pacific
The Americas exhibit robust demand driven by advanced livestock industries and expanding aquaculture operations. In North America, stringent feed regulations and consumer focus on sustainable protein sources bolster investment in high-quality feed additives. Latin American markets leverage abundant agricultural resources, yet face challenges around infrastructure and logistical bottlenecks, prompting companies to establish local blending facilities to reduce transportation costs and enhance responsiveness to seasonal demand fluctuations.In Europe, stringent environmental and feed safety regulations have elevated adoption of certified feed ingredients, while the Middle East and Africa are characterized by fragmented markets with varying regulatory landscapes. European producers benefit from harmonized standards that streamline cross-border trade, yet must navigate complex compliance frameworks. In contrast, the Middle East and Africa present high-growth potential fueled by rising consumption of animal protein and government-led agricultural modernization programs, yet require tailored market entry strategies to address diverse import tariffs and distribution challenges.
Asia Pacific remains the fastest evolving region, propelled by population growth, rising disposable incomes, and a shift toward value-added food products. In China and India, rapid expansion of aquaculture and poultry sectors drives consistent demand for feed-grade choline chloride, while Japan and South Korea emphasize high-purity grades for supplement and pharmaceutical applications. Infrastructure improvements and evolving regulatory environments across Southeast Asian markets are unlocking new opportunities, even as companies grapple with varying quality standards and supply chain complexities.
